About

The character "椅" originally denoted a specific variety of tree, such as the catalpa, and its structure incorporates the semantic radical "木" for wood alongside the phonetic component "奇". Over time, as the use of wooden seating furniture became widespread, the term was applied to the object itself, shifting its primary meaning from the tree to the chair. This semantic transition capitalized on the character's existing association with wood through its radical, while the form itself continued to be composed of the same elements.
